Environment + Sustainability
$6.2B
Renewable Energy Solutions
Generated $6.2 billion in revenues from renewable energy infrastructure solutions in 2023.
4.3GW
Utility-Scale Projects
Constructed 4.3 gigawatts of utility-scale wind, solar, and battery storage capacity in 2023.
100GW
Renewable Capacity Target
Committed to building at least 100 gigawatts of renewable energy capacity by 2035 or earlier.
%3.5
CO₂ Emissions Intensity
Reduced Scope 1 CO₂ emissions intensity by 3.5% year-over-year in 2023.
